on the environmental front, BLOX is equipped with a roofing solar system, three layers of high-insulating glass facades and LED lighting. Just to name some of the innovative solutions. “Our goal has been to think sustainably without compromising the architectural aspirations. At the same time comfort is a crucial parameter, in terms of noise, indoor climate and installations,” says Peter Fangel Poulsen. Meeting different needs A key stakeholder in the development of BLOX is the Danish Architecture Centre, which is one of the main users and the public attraction in the building that invites everyone in for exhibitions and debates. CEO Kent Martinussen is happy about the result and the new environment will add value to the work carried out by the Danish Architecture Centre. “We are totally thrilled about this new multifunctional building. It’s almost like a small town in itself with flats on the rooftop, parking in the basement, workspaces for the whole building industry, day care centres, restaurants, café, fitness centre and the DAC in the centre of the building. We want our guests to start visiting Denmark and Copenhagen here,” Kent Martinussen explains. The building also hosts BLOXHUB – a place where companies, organisations and researchers are working with different aspects of sustainable urban development.
